Neil Holloway Joins Microsoft Dynamics Leadership Team as Michael Park Departs for Server and Tools

David Gumpert Profile Picture David Gumpert 1,290

Corporate vice president of Microsoft Business Solutions Michael Park is leaving the Dynamics team, to be replaced by long time Microsoft UK veteran Neil Holloway.  Holloway's current position is "VP of Business Strategy", but past roles have included VP of Microsoft International and president of Microsoft EMEA.

Holloway's new role will not match all of the exact responsibilities of Park, but will be quite close, Microsoft officials say in confirming the move. Park will be moving to a leadership role in the Server and Tools business, which includes SQL Server, Windows Server, Windows Azure, and Visual Studio and business intelligence tools like PowerPivot.
